Hello,

I see in VBox 1.6 on Solaris if switched to host solaudio sound output seems to work (I've been able to hear Skype's ringing), the problem is that it seems sound input is not implemented yet, at least this message from log suggests it:

00:00:02.560 Audio: Trying driver 'solaudio'.
00:00:02.569 Audio: set_record_source ars=0 als=0 (not implemented)
00:00:02.569 AC97: WARNING: Unable to open PCM IN!
00:00:02.569 AC97: WARNING: Unable to open PCM MC!
00:00:02.591 Console: VM runtime error: fatal=false, errorID=HostAudioNotResponding message="Some audio devices (PCM_in, PCM_mic) could not
be opened. Guest applications generating audio output or depending on audio input may hang. Make sure your host audio device is working pr
operly. Check the logfile for error messages of the audio subsystem."

My question is: do you plan to make sound input working too?
